《zen cart》免费的购物车软件。
基本介绍
用于建立自己的网上商店,为网上销售商而设计。Zen Cart是一个免费、界面友好,开放式源码的购物车软件。该软件由一些销售商、程序员、设计师和顾问们共同开发,目的就是用户能建立风格不同的电子商务系统。现有的一些解决方案过重于编程,而不是着眼于客户的需求。Zen Cart把销售商和购物者的需求放在第一位。同时,那些程序如果没有专业人员,几乎不可能安装成功,而一个有基本计算机知识的人就会安装Zen Cart。另外那些程序也非常昂贵,而Zen Cart是完全免费! 通过Zen Cart浏览商品将会变得轻而易举。除了传统的目录清单,该程序还提供几个特色商品目录。商品加入购物车后,只要简单的三步就可以安全结帐。客户填写交货地址,选择交货方式(含多种交货方式,内置网上实时运费报价)。然后,从多种流行的付款方式中任选一种(例如,PayPal和 AuthorizeNet)。最后,客户复查订单、交付方式和付款选择,然后确认订单。您可以立即得到订单通知,客户也会收到电子邮件的订单确认 。
特点介绍
* 容易安装
* 容易定制
* 自动化,例如订单确认
* 方便浏览
* 内置的促销、折扣、礼物券、新闻简讯和商品通知功能
* 单件商品优惠或者全部商品折扣,团体优惠和大订单优惠
* 内置搜索优化工具
* 密码保护的管理员工具
* 支持多种语言、货币和税率结构
简而言之,Zen Cart包括了购物车软件所应该具备的所有功能。
优化
众所周知,Zen cart是最好的网店程序之一,但与生俱来的一些程序问题干扰了
站内搜索引擎优化。所以需要通过
插件的应用及2次开发来达到我们更好的通过搜索引擎销售产品的目的。 1.测试首页、频道页、内页的meta属性(主要包括标题、描述与关键词以及版权等信息),根据页面匹配性,将关键词有效的布局在每个页面内,最好可以达到自由编写的水平。
2.正确书写
robots.txt和站内nofollow属性,屏蔽部分与页面优化冲突或者不应被搜索引擎抓捕的目录和页面。
3.保证多种语言版本网站内容的收录和有效索引: Google
网站管理员指南明确指出:“允许搜索蜘蛛机器人在不采用会跟踪其在网站上浏览路径的会话 ID 或参数的情况下抓取您的网站。这些技术对跟踪单个用户的行为非常有用,但蜘蛛机器人的访问模式却完全不同。”比如zencart程序产生的 index.php?main_page=site_map与index.php?main_page=site_map& language=gb内容完全一致,导致重复页面的产生,显然会降低整个网站在
搜索引擎算法评估中得出的质量。解决方法可以参考本文2.提到的方式。
4.针对性强的页面静态化并使其具有良好的结构(注意控制路径长度,例如由Ethan开发的 SEO3.0模块提供了简单模式和Diy模式两种url模式):以产品和产品目录页面为核心,构建核心明确、相关度高的站内结构;产业页面内容唯一、不与其他页面重复;站内导入链接无误,由于更新等原因失效的错误页面使用404.htm;重要的产品及目录页面在网站大型调整后要保证url不变,已做变化的需要将原路径
301永久重定向到新页面;首页确定主域名后,其他域名301定向到主域名。
5.适合中英文等不同语言包的优化插件。
6.生成sitemap或rss feed并提交。
内部优化
1,在网页内部优化中,title是最重要的地方。Zen cart虽然能自动生成的title(主要包含了商品名称,内含主打 关键词),但在SEO 竞争日益激烈的今天,光做一个主打关键词是不够的,应该衍生出一些组合词,在title中体现。这样虽然费点事,却很值得。所以
网站优化应该高度强调建站 系统的页面title要能自由编辑,而不仅仅是自动呈现商品名称或文章标题等。
2,description、keywords的重要性低 于页面的可见文字部分。
3,虽然description、keywords已经不再重要,但是在SEO竞争日益激烈的今天,
细节决定成败。 Zen Cart商品分类可以无限分级,所有分类页面和所有商品页面的title、description、keywords 可以自由编辑,特别是商品页面的title有多个自动填充选项,在这一点上对SEO的考虑可以说到了极致。
一,自由编辑商品页面的title、description、keywords。
进入后台,在商品管理–〉商品分类里新建分类和商品后,在商品列表的最右边可以看到类似风轮的图标,黑的为meta标签未定 义,红的为meta标签已定义,默认为黑色。
很多人用Zen Cart建站后,从来没有点击这个风轮,风轮永远是 黑色,没有充分利用Zen Cart提供的最重要的SEO手段。
黑色意味着页面的title、description、keywords为系统自动生成的。
title为: 商品名称+[商品编号]+PRIMARY_SECTION+TITLE+TERTIARY_SECTION+SITE_TAGLINE description为: TITLE+商品名称+[商品编号]+SECONDARY_SECTION+商品简介
keywords为: 商品名称+[商品编号]+所有一级商品分类的名称
注意上面的 PRIMARY_SECTION、TITLE、TERTIARY_SECTION、SITE_TAGLINE、SECONDARY_SECTION可以在meta_tags.php(/includes/languages /english/meta_tags.php)文件里自由设定。
问题很明显:title关键词覆盖面窄,description太长,keywords里所有一级商品分类的名称是很离谱的。 然而Zen Cart作为国际顶级的网店系统,提供了神奇的风轮。
光点击进风轮是不变红的,必须在随后出现的页面的当前语言的 title、description、keywords编辑 栏里输入东西才变红,唯有如此,系统才会放弃自动生成的title、description、keywords,而采用人工输入的title、 description、keywords,实现自由编辑。
二 注重用户友好
1. 正确使用zen cart栏 目的页面标题 用心设置好商城系统中每一个栏目标题会为店家带来意想不到的效果。标签是很重要的,尽量用一些描述性强的关键词。
2. 页面中的商品的图片 商品图片要真实、清晰、吸引人。大量的商品图片,注重结构分明,任何一个搜索引擎都喜欢结构明显,而不喜欢把页面做成一张皮,让搜索引擎分不清你的重点所在。
3. 上传产品时千万不要把成千上万个产品图全部放在Images目录下,那样会让产品详细页(Product Details)运行缓慢,要为多图的产品单独目录存放
4.文案导 航里面的内容要写的清晰明了切忌笼统用户没那么时间去看那些如(FAQ Conditions of Use shopping $ Returns)
5.用户购买及注册的提示信息要友好最好能让客 户安安心心的注册开开心心的购买
设置
商店
1、基础设置:
修改(商店名称) 根据自己店铺设置
2、客户资料
修改(创建账号时的缺省国家) 为主销售国家
修改(显示电子商情选择框) 为0
3、配送参数
修改(始发国家或地区) 为自己店铺始发地,默认中国
修改(邮编) 为自己店铺始发地邮编,似乎没什么用
修改(最大包裹重量) 为10000,表示店铺最大单包裹上限10公斤
修改(大包裹包装材料) 为10:1,表示包裹总重量的每10%增加1克作为包装重量
修改(在发票管理中显示订单说明) 为2
修改(在装箱单管理中显示订单说明) 为2
4、电子邮件
修改(SMTP账号邮箱) 为管理员邮箱账号 -或另设置,但不推荐
修改(SMTP账号密码) 为管理员邮箱密码 -或另设置,但不推荐
注:要是有些服务器需要用到smtpauth的话,这两个必须要填写。。
修改(SMTP主机) 为管理员邮箱SMTP主机 -Gmail=sm tp . gm ail. com,其他信箱根据信箱要求设置
修改(SMTP服务器端口) 为邮件SMTP主机端口 -Gmail=465
5、属性设置
修改(允许下载) 为false
6、布局设置
修改(分类栏 – 显示特价商品链接) 为false -本处为自由设置,请根据个人情况而定
修改(分类栏 – 显示新进商品链接) 为false -本处为自由设置,请根据个人情况而定
修改(分类栏 – 显示推荐商品链接) 为false -本处为自由设置,请根据个人情况而定
修改(广告显示组 – 标题位置 1) 为空
修改(广告显示组 – 标题位置 3) 为空
修改(顾客欢迎词 – 显示在首页) 为1
7、新进商品
修改(显示商品名称) 为2105
修改(显示商品加入日期) 为0
8、推荐商品
修改(显示商品名称) 为2105
修改(显示商品加入日期) 为0
9、所有商品
修改(显示商品名称) 为2105
修改(显示商品加入日期) 为0
10、定义页面
修改(定义优惠券说明) 为3
修改(定义页面二) 为3
修改(定义页面三) 为3
修改(定义页面四) 为3
商品管理
1、商品类型
修改(商品 – 普通)
-选择编辑布局->显示厂商 修改为False
-选择编辑布局->显示上市日期 修改为False
-选择编辑布局->显示加入日期 修改为False
模块管理
1、支付模块
修改(信用卡 – 脱机处理) 选择卸载
修改(免费商品) 选择卸载
修改(PayPal IPN – Website Payments Standard) 选择安装
-商业编号 =输入Paypal主EMAIL
-PDT Token =输入Paypal内分配PDT Token
-交易货币 =默认,不选择
-其他均为默认,然后确认安装
2、配送模块
修改(固定运费) 选择卸载
修改(免运费) 选择卸载
修改(按件计价) 选择卸载
修改(商店提货) 选择卸载
修改(标准运费) 选择安装
-如果使用邮政小包,请输入以下内容,其他选项默认
(说明:本处运费描述方式为,参考下方EMS运费范例)
100:2.2,200:3.7,300:5.2,400:6.7,500:8.2,600:9.7,700:11.2,800:12.7,900:14.2,1000:15.7
修改(地区运费) 选择安装
-此处为EMS选择,以下为EMS 3.6折运费,如使用UPS或DHL,请另计算以及说明
范例 : 500 : 13.5 ,
单位:克 对应运费符号 运费价格 下一级运费分割符
以上为范例描述,请严格按照以下方式书写
地区1
US,CA
500:13.5,1000:17.5,1500:21.5,2000:25.5,2500:29.5,3000:33.5,3500:37.5,4000:41.5
地区2
BE,GB,FR,DK,FI,GR,AT,IE,NO,PT,DE,SE
500:15.3,1000:19.8,1500:24.3,2000:28.8,2500:33.3,3000:37.8,3500:42.3,4000:46.8
地区3
AU,NZ
500:11.5,1000:14.5,1500:17.5,2000:20.5,2500:23.5,3000:26.5,3500:29.5,4000:32.5
3、总额计算
修改(团体优惠) 选择卸载
修改(礼券) 选择卸载
修改(低额订单费) 选择卸载
修改(税额) 选择卸载
界面设定
1、货币代码
修改(人民币) 选择卸载
修改(Canadian Dollar) 选择卸载
点击更新货币
修改对应货币汇率,自动更新相对不够准确,货币价值兑换有点吃亏,本处可将PAYPAL的2.5%兑换费用增加进去
工具/TOOLS
1、模板选择
根据自己需要使用模板修改,本处请注意,中文与英文模板均需要修改,否则会造成错误
2、外观控制/Layout Boxes Controller
请尽量对应选择,选择语言为简体中文时,此处修改的为中文模板,选择语言为英文时,此处修改的为英文模板
文件名——————————模块名——————功能—————————所显示的位置
sideboxes/search.php—————-搜索(带高级搜索)——–对产品进行搜索—————–左边
sideboxes/search_header.php———搜索(简单的搜索)——–对产品进行搜索—————–左边
sideboxes/shopping_cart.php———购物车——————显示所订购的商品—————左边
sideboxes/categories.php————分类——————–按产品的类别分类—————左边
sideboxes/manufactures.php———-品牌——————–显示所有产品的品牌————-左边
sideboxes/payment.php—————支付——————–付款(logo形式出现)————-左边
sideboxes/document_categories.php—文档类商品————–通常指可以下载的商品类型——-左边
sideboxes/order_history.php———订单历史—————-以往订单的历史记录————-左边
sideboxes/reviews.php—————评论——————–买家对所买商品的评价———–左边
sideboxes/featured.php————–推荐商品—————-随机显示推荐商品,在后台设—–左边
sideboxes/banner_box.php————赞助商——————显示赞助商家——————-左边
sideboxes/login_box.php————-登录——————–显示费员的登录入口————-右边
sideboxes/information.php———–消息——————–显示商家的最新消息————-右边
sideboxes/more_information.php——更多消息—————-展示更多的消息—————–右边
sideboxes/whos_online.php———–在线名单—————-显示有多少人在线—————右边
sideboxes/what_new.php————–新登商品—————-显示新登产品(随机)————-右边
sideboxes/music_genres.php———-音乐流派—————-显示音乐的流派—————–右边
sideboxes/record_companies.php——唱片公司—————-显示唱片公司——————-右边
sideboxes/weblink_box.php———–友情连接—————-以logo的形式显示连接———–右边
sideboxes/best_sellers.php———-畅销商品—————-随机显示畅销商品—————右边
sideboxes/manufacture_info.php——厂家消息—————-显示具体产品时在右边显示出来—右边
sideboxes/specials.php————–特价商品—————-随机显示特价商品,在后台设置—右边
sideboxes/product_notifications.php-商品通知—————-买家知道新的产品可以通知卖家—右边
sideboxes/tell_a_friend.php———推荐给朋友————–如果感觉商品很好可以推荐给朋友-右边
sideboxes/languages.php————-语言——————–以何种语言显示—————–右边
sideboxes/currencies.php————货币——————–以何货币付款——————-右边
sideboxes/banner_box2.php———–不明——————–做相应的logo连接—————右边
一般情况下 可以关闭以下模块
sideboxes/manufactures.php
sideboxes/document_categories.php(这个很好用的。。)
sideboxes/banner_box.php
sideboxes/more_information.php
sideboxes/what_new.php
sideboxes/music_genres.php
sideboxes/record_companies.php
sideboxes/weblink_box.php(没有就不用理了)
sideboxes/manufacture_info.php
sideboxes/product_notifications.php
其他模块根据自己情况去调整
3、广告管理
修改所有广告项目的状态为关闭(绿色状态按钮点成红色)
4、管理设置
此处可增加管理员名单,以及修改管理员密码等,可增设管理名单,以方便工人登陆上货
5、简易页面管理/EZ-Pages(在编辑的时候,排序的值必须大于0 或者不显示出来)
本处也需要同时修改中英文,或者仅修改英文也可
修改(Home) 选择编辑-页眉排序: 5
选择Header开启
修改(Register) 选择编辑-页眉排序: 10
修改(News) 选择Header关闭
修改(Site Map) 选择Header开启
选择编辑-页眉排序: 90
6、图像管理
选择安装图象管理
特别注意
OK,到此,基本上,一个一般可以运行的网站已经在后台调整完毕,但还有一些需要微调的东西如下
1、修改Paypal.pap模块,否则收到的钱都是未提供地址的,方法如下
2、将网站根目录的htaccess_sample修改为” .htaccess “,并用记事本打开此文件,修改其中的 /shop/ 为您的zen cart目录。
如果Zen Cart安装在网页服务器的根目录下,就设置为 /
3、商店设置->搜索引擎优化,选择打开
4、安装GOOGLE SITMAPS,并且根据说明制作SITMAP XML文件,上传到GOOGLE去,当然,YAHOO,MSN的也可以在这时一起做了
5、安装RSS,建议可以同时把两个RSS模块都安装上
6、修改在结帐时购物车显示的运费名称,修改如下
模板
所谓zen cart模板,就是使用在zen cart购物车系统上面的,更改网站前台整体样式的一个文件。通过更换不同的模板,可以显示不同的网站前端界面, 而不会更改到您的网站数据。
独立模板
严格来说 模板是与程序相独立的
只要严格遵循Zen Cart程序的替代机制制作的模板 可以随意在对应的标准的程序版本间任意移植,理论上 这样的模板也能向前兼容或大部分兼容之前版本的程序,这样的模板 称之为Zen Cart独立模板.
Zen Cart 模板的优缺点:
Zen Cart 独立模板对程序日后的维护与升级干扰小或无干扰等诸多优点,对当前以有数据的网站, 几乎无影响 无破坏;
但独立模板的缺点也有, 独立模板安装完成后, 都需要自己或多或少的去进行一些相关的功能配置后
才能达到最佳的展示效果, 因此不利于快速部署网站; 不利于对Zen Cart 程序不熟悉或掌握程度不够深的用户使用.
整合模板
与程序整合在一起的模板 称之为整合模板, 这样的模板最大的特点就是 方便安装 可以快速部署网站. 但随模板一起的程序 出于作者的一些情况和个人喜好及需要等, 导致最终的程序自主性 规范性 稍欠, 对程序日后的运营维护上 有一定的潜在运维风险. 整合模板的安装大多为颠覆性的, 因此不适用于以经有大量数据的网站或以经在正常运营的网站应用, 只适合需要快速部署和快速投入运营的新建网站应用
模板引擎
基于Zen cart前端模板机制,重构前端引擎二次研发的国产程序:OpenzcTPL模板引擎,能够快速制作前端模板,省去繁杂的动态语言编写,注重于前端代码编写,并且整合全静态缓存机制,大大提升了访问速度。
IPN模板
1. 登录.PayPal账户
2. 点击 Profile.
3. 点击 Add or Edit Email.
4. 记下 primary 邮件地址, 注意大小写. (下面要填写完全一致的邮件地址)
5. 点击 Profile 返回 Profile Summary.
6. 点击 Instant Payment Notification
Preferences.
7. 点击 Edit.
8. 打开 (选中方框).
9. 设置 Notification URL 为:
(具体请参考zencart模块后台的提示)
10. 点击 Save.
11. 点击 Website Payment Preferences.
12. Auto Return for Website Payments - 设置为 on.
ZEN CART 后台
1. 管理页面 > 模块管理 > 支付模块 > PayPal IPN - Website
Payments Standard.
2. 如果是初次设置 PayPal, 请点击:安装.
3. 否者, 点击:编辑.
4. 输入前面记下的PayPal账户的 primary 邮件地址.
5. 设置其它选项.
6. 注意页面上提示的网址 - 必须与前面的PayPal Profile中设置的一致.
常用插件
一、编辑器插件(MCE编辑器)与FCK编辑器功能差不多。具体用哪个看个人习惯咯。
二、多图局部放大插件(在产品详细列表页
鼠标经过图像时,图像会变大)
三、多图点击放大插件(在产品详细列表页鼠标点击图像时,图像弹出变大图片)
四、支付宝插件
五、历史浏览插件(当顾客访问过产品时,一般会在边栏显示你近期访问过的产品)
六、FAQ管理插件(顾客可以通过访问网站提交问题,管理员在后台回答后设置显示即可在前台展示问题和答案)
七、产品批量上传插件(在后台批量上传产品的一个插件)
八、带管理员权限设置插件(操作在后台可设置各管理员的权限)
九、博客插件
十、在线支付折扣插件
十一、注册优化插件
十二、积分插件
十三、RSS订阅插件(使用RSS订阅功能的一个小插件)
十四、销售分析插件
十五、在线客服插件(MSN,SKYPE等相关的软件能在线交流)
十六、友情链接管理插件
十七、产品收藏夹插件(客户注册登陆后可以将产品收藏到自己的账户中)
十八、产品比对插件(比较两个产品的不同点及相同点)
十九、批量添加商品到购物车插件(可以同时添加不同属性商品)
二十、数据库备份插件(可以在后台备份数据库)
二十一、SEO伪静态插件(这个是SEO必备插件,对搜索引擎非常友好)
二十二、产品布局插件(zencart默认的是竖排,可以改变成横排)